Application

三甘醇可用于以下情形:
  • 制备脂肪酸胶凝器,用于胶凝各种食用油和植物油。
  • 作为溶剂制备超顺磁性氧化铁纳米颗粒,用于原位蛋白纯化。
  • 在水下天然气脱水制程中作为吸收剂。
